MakerWorld
Sculptures
Freedom Dove Statue
by DJSGXII
242
Downloads
68
Likes
102
Makes
In the story of Noah's Ark, a dove returns with an olive leaf, signifying the end of the great flood and the restoration of peace on Earth.Depending on how you print it, you need hardly any support material. Some afterprint love is required though - which is only symbolically justifiable. If you make one, please share the results!
Sign in to leave a comment
Sign in